Les humains poss\u00e8dent environ 350 g\u00e8nes de r\u00e9cepteurs olfactifs qui peuvent chacun d\u00e9tecter un certain nombre de compos\u00e9s odorants diff\u00e9rents qui, ensemble, peuvent cr\u00e9er un grand nombre de parfums diff\u00e9rents. Cependant, lorsqu&rsquo;ils sont pr\u00e9sent\u00e9s avec la m\u00eame odeur, diff\u00e9rentes personnes varient dans leur capacit\u00e9 \u00e0 identifier l&rsquo;odeur. Cette \u00e9tude d&rsquo;association \u00e0 l&rsquo;\u00e9chelle du g\u00e9nome a examin\u00e9 les g\u00e9nomes de plus de 11 000 Islandais pour identifier les diff\u00e9rences g\u00e9n\u00e9tiques sous-jacentes dans la d\u00e9tection de l&rsquo;odeur de cannelle. Les chercheurs ont d\u00e9couvert une r\u00e9gion du g\u00e9nome associ\u00e9e \u00e0 la capacit\u00e9 d&rsquo;un individu \u00e0 reconna\u00eetre l&rsquo;odeur de la cannelle.
